Understanding Buy Sell Agreements

A buy-sell agreement is a contract that governs how an owner’s share is sold or transferred if they leave, retire, become disabled, or pass away.

These agreements provide clear triggers, pricing methods, funding mechanisms, and timelines to maintain stability.

Definition and Explanation

A buy-sell agreement is a legally binding document among business owners that sets out triggers for buyouts, the method used to value shares, and the process for funding and completing a transfer.

Key Elements and Processes

Key elements include buyout triggers, valuation methods, funding arrangements, and agreed-upon timelines. The process typically involves negotiation, drafting, review, and final execution.

Key Terms and Glossary

This glossary explains common terms used in buy-sell agreements to help owners and managers understand commitments.

Valuation Method

The approach used to determine the price for a buyout, such as agreed formula, appraisal, or a multiple of earnings.

Purchase Price Adjustment

Adjustments to the purchase price after initial valuation to reflect changes in business value between signing and closing.

Trigger Event

Specific events that activate the buyout, including death, disability, retirement, or voluntary withdrawal.

Funding Mechanism

The means by which a buyout is funded, such as life insurance, installment payments, or reserve funds.

What is a buy-sell agreement?

A buy-sell agreement is a contract among owners that sets terms for buying and selling interests under certain events. It can specify triggers, valuation methods, and the process for completing a buyout to keep the business stable. By outlining roles and responsibilities, it helps prevent disputes and ensures a smoother transition.
